.clear{ clear:both; line-height:0;}

#top{ width:977px;}
#nav{ height:79px; position:relative; margin:10px 0 7px 0;}
#nav .s{ position:absolute;background:url(/images/navsearchbjs.png) no-repeat; height:28px; width:977px; top:0;left:0;}
#nav .x{ position:absolute; background:url(/images/navsearchbj.png) no-repeat; height:51px; width:977px; top:27px; left:0;}
.search{ margin:10px 0 0 250px;}
.search .ipt{ background:url(/images/searchk.png) no-repeat; width:321px; height:28px; border:0; line-height:28px; padding-left:30px;}

/*¹«ÓÃUL,LI*/
.hlb{ color:#333333; height:28px; margin-left:6px;}
.hlb ul{ margin:0; padding:0;}
.hlb li{list-style-type:none;padding:0; margin:0;line-height:28px; height:28px;width:80px; float:left; position:relative; font-size:14px; float:left; text-align:center;}
.hlb li a:link,
.hlb li a:visited {color:#333333; text-decoration:none;}
.hlb li a:hover,
.hlb li a:active { display:block;color:#ffffff; font-weight:bold; background:url(/images/hoverbj.png) no-repeat; width:75px; height:28px;}

